Elliott Smith

From a Basement on a Hill

2004-10-23

On October 21st of 2003, word came down that elusive songwriter Elliott Smith had apparently committed suicide in his Los Angeles home. The news brought a sad end to a critically-lauded and popularly-ignored career - and a life that spanned only 34 years.

Since his passing, the Elliott Smith legend has grown. Often cited for carrying the torch of Nick Drake, acts have already begun to spring up to carry on Elliott’s sound.

The followers will have to wait, though, as Elliott Smith’s final musical statement, recorded during the last two years of his life, now makes its way to stores.
